Joseph John Deacon, author and disability advocate, overcame severe cerebral palsy to write his autobiography.

Joseph John Deacon (1920–1981) was a British author and advocate for individuals with disabilities. Born with severe cerebral palsy, his condition significantly impacted his motor control and speech, leading some to mistakenly believe he had intellectual impairments. Despite these challenges, Deacon demonstrated intelligence through non-verbal communication and, with the assistance of friends, authored his autobiography, 'Tongue Tied' (1974). This work, published by Mencap, offered insights into the lives of those with physical disabilities.

Deacon's life and the collaborative effort behind his book were the subject of television documentaries, including the BAFTA-winning 'Joey' by the Horizon program. Royalties from his book and donations enabled him and his friends to move into more independent housing. While his unique speech and mannerisms brought him public attention, they also unfortunately led to him being a subject of ridicule among some children. A charity, The Deacon Centre, was later established to continue his legacy.

Early Life and Challenges

Joseph John Deacon was born in 1920 with severe cerebral palsy, a condition affecting his neuromuscular system, particularly his limbs. This resulted in significant muscle spasticity, hindering fine motor control in his hands and legs. While he could walk with assistance, he primarily used a wheelchair. His speech was also difficult for most to understand. Institutionalized as a child, Deacon's communication difficulties led to him being misjudged as having intellectual impairments by some. However, his mother recognized his cognitive abilities, devising non-verbal tests like counting cars by blinking. Throughout his childhood, he proved his intelligence through various non-verbal assessments during hospital stays. Despite multiple unsuccessful leg surgeries and the early loss of his mother, Deacon maintained contact with his father.

Authoring 'Tongue Tied'

In 1970, Deacon embarked on writing his autobiography, 'Tongue Tied,' a project undertaken with the support of three close friends. Ernie Roberts, who also had cerebral palsy and could understand Deacon's speech, acted as a crucial intermediary, transcribing Deacon's dictation. Michael Sangster wrote down the dictated text, and Tom Blackburn, after teaching himself to type, produced the final manuscript. The process took fourteen months for the forty-four-page book. 'Tongue Tied' was published by Mencap as part of their 'Subnormality in the Seventies' series, providing a personal perspective on living with physical disabilities. The book's publication garnered significant attention, including features on BBC Radio 4 and a BBC television documentary.

Later Life and Legacy

The friendship between Deacon and his collaborators endured for decades within the hospital setting. Their bond and the creation of 'Tongue Tied' were highlighted in the award-winning television documentary 'Joey.' Following the success of his autobiography, Deacon and his friends began work on a fictional novel, though it remained unpublished. Funds raised from 'Tongue Tied' and donations allowed the four friends to move into a bungalow on the hospital grounds in 1979, fostering greater independence. Deacon passed away in 1981. His story later served as the basis for a medical journal article assessing intelligence in individuals with communication impairments, demonstrating Deacon's normal cognitive abilities. In 2020, a charity named The Deacon Centre was established to honor his legacy, offering creative programs for individuals with mental and communication disabilities.
